Market Performance - The Hang Seng Index (HSI) closed down 8 points at 26,438, after reaching a four-year high of 26,601 earlier in the day[1] - The Shanghai Composite Index (SSE) rose 1 point, closing at 3,861, with a trading volume of 9,898 billion yuan[1] - The total market turnover in Hong Kong was 294.007 billion HKD[1] U.S. Market Trends - The S&P 500 index fell 8 points to close at 6,606 after hitting a new high of 6,626[1] - The Nasdaq Composite dropped 14 points to 22,333, while the Dow Jones Industrial Average decreased by 125 points or 0.3%, closing at 45,757[1] Economic Indicators - The unemployment rate in Hong Kong for June to August was reported at 3.7%, unchanged from the previous period and below the market expectation of 3.8%[3] - The underemployment rate increased from 1.4% to 1.6% during the same period[3] Corporate Developments - Chery Automobile plans to issue 297 million H shares at a price range of 27.75 to 30.75 HKD, aiming to raise up to 9.145 billion HKD[3] - GAC Group and Huawei have launched a high-end smart electric vehicle brand named "Qijing," integrating both companies' manufacturing and technology strengths[4]
